IDC Cross-Industry Digital Twin Framework: dove l'innovazione incontra la strategia

Dai singoli prodotti agli interi ecosistemi, come sviluppare iniziative digital twin per i diversi settori verticali

I cosiddetti “gemelli digitali” sono diventati sempre più importanti in un ampio spettro di settori, estendendosi ben oltre quelli tradizionalmente noti per queste applicazioni, come per esempio il manufacturing. Per sostenerne la diffusione, IDC ha elaborato un framework in grado di guidare lo sviluppo di strategie digital twin end-to-end in tutti i settori: dalla sanità al finance, dal manifatturiero all’energy, dal government e il transportation al retail.

Enterprise Technical Debt: Liability or Lever?

Much like financial leverage, tech debt leverage carries risks, and managing it becomes paramount. As with financial leverage, the problem with tech debt arises when it accumulates without making technological payments against that debt over time. As companies become more digital, they need to actively measure and manage their tech debt leverage the same way they do their financial debt leverage. To do this, it is imperative to know how to calculate it and have a common language for discussing it with the executive team and the board. Without both, tech debt is a pure liability that hampers innovation and delays transformative efforts within enterprises.

By proactively measuring and managing enterprise tech debt and establishing a common business language with which to contain that measurement, CIOs can elevate the discussion of tech debt within their organization. This concept enables tech debt to become another lever that can be pulled to help meet strategic goals while the prioritization of efforts to pay tech debt interest is consciously addressed by the executive team.
